⚠️ The Hidden Cost of Ignoring STQC Early 

Many OEMs and product startups treat STQC like an afterthought — a final checkbox before launch — instead of a core engineering requirement. This misstep frequently leads to: 

  • Sensor misalignment  

  • Delays due to non-conforming illumination or liveness detection requirements 

  • Broken firmware pipelines with improper image compression 

  • Integration failures with UIDAI-certified SDKs and APIs 

 

Each of these issues introduces costly reworks, failed certification attempts, and months of delay, pushing your launch further away.
